Integumentary system: forms external body covering, protects deeper tissues, synthesizes vitamin d and houses cutaneous receptors, sweat and oil glands. Skeletal system: protects and supports organs, assists muscles with movement, houses blood cell formation in red bone marrow and stores minerals in bones. Muscular system: allows locomotion and facial expression, maintains posture and produces heat. Nervous system: responds to internal and external changes by activating appropriate muscles and glands. Endocrine system: glands secrete hormones that regulate processes such as growth, reproduction and metabolism. Cardiovascular system: blood pumps blood that is transported by blood vessels, carrying o, Lymphatic system: creates immune response against foreign substances, picks up fluid leaked from blood vessels and returns it to blood, disposes of debris in lymphatic stream, houses wbcs (lymphocytes) Respiratory system: supplies blood with oxygen, removes co2. Digestive system: breaks down food into absorbable units and eliminates indigestible foods as feces.
